Exactly How Cold Laser Therapy Functions
To comprehend exactly how cold laser treatment functions, you need to comprehend the fundamental concepts of just how light power interacts with biological cells. Cold laser therapy, likewise known as low-level laser treatment (LLLT), utilizes specific wavelengths of light to pass through the skin and target underlying cells. Unlike the extreme lasers used in surgeries, cold lasers emit low levels of light that don't generate heat or create damages to the cells.
When these mild light waves get to the cells, they're absorbed by elements called chromophores, such as cytochrome c oxidase in mitochondria. This absorption triggers a collection of biological actions, consisting of increased mobile energy production and the launch of nitric oxide, which boosts blood flow and lowers inflammation.
Moreover, the light power can also promote the production of adenosine triphosphate (ATP), the power money of cells, assisting in cellular repair and regeneration procedures.
In essence, cold laser treatment uses the power of light power to advertise healing and ease pain in a non-invasive and gentle fashion.

Therapeutic Effects
Recognizing the therapeutic impacts of cold laser treatment entails identifying how the boosted mobile metabolism and anti-inflammatory residential or commercial properties add to its positive results on organic cells.
When the cold laser is applied to the afflicted area, it stimulates the mitochondria within the cells, bring about raised production of adenosine triphosphate (ATP), which is important for mobile feature and repair. This boost in cellular power increases the recovery process by promoting cells regeneration and lowering swelling.
